The Feather Of A White Dove
Date: Tuesday, 1st April 2008 @ 10:53:05 AM AEST
Topic: Sad Poetry


Contributed By: honey56

I clung to your embrace
As your last breathe fled
Into the heavens bliss

Upon the feather of a white
Dove

Oh gently did the feather
Sail
Through the wind
Descending into the heavens

I think the heavens cried that
Day

For the clouds just rumble as
The tears started to pour

I thought I seen a beautiful white
Dove

Just perched upon your shoulder
As I clung to your embrace

Your last breathe silently fled
Upon the feather of the white dove

Oh gently did the feather sail

As the clouds began to rumble
And the tears overflowed

As you descended so gracefully
Into the heavens bliss

On the feather of a white dove
